Paisley Lodge Care Home in Leeds offers specialist dementia care and mental health care, within two dedicated Reconnect communities offering individualised care for your loved one.

Part of Orchard Healthcare Group and rated ‘Good’ by CQC (July 2024), the home has 41 bedrooms, comfortable living spaces and activity areas designed to promote independence and engagement. Each community is specifically crafted to ensure your loved ones are feel safe, cared for and...

My name is Craig, and I'm the Home Manager at Paisley Lodge Care Home in Leeds.

I started as a Care Assistant in 1999 with a focus on dementia care, and became a Registered Nurse in Mental Health in 2005. Since then, I've become qualified in Dementia Care Mapping and managed many services over the last decade - as you can probably tell, I'm very passionate about all areas of mental health, including dementia!

I joined the Paisley Lodge team in 2025 and have really enjoyed getting to know the residents and family members. Feel free to come say hi anytime!
